GERMANY AND ITALY

GREAT AND FRUITFUL FUTURE WILL FACILITATE PERMANENT PEACE THE WORLD'S OPPOSITION & LACK OF UNDERSTANDING (United Press Assn.—Elec. Tel. Copyright) Received May 9, 11 a.m.) ROME, May 8 Herr Hitler, at a banquet in Rome, said: “Italy and Germany had to defend themselves against a world filled with opposition and lack of understanding, and gradually cordial friendship has developed between the two peoples, the solidarity of which has been tested by events in recent years. These events have demonstrated to the world that the legitimate and vital interests of the great nations must in all cases be taken into account. “It is self-apparent that our work of understanding will go forward. I know for Italy and Germany there is a great and fruitful future. Italy and Germany together will not only facilitate permanent peace, but with their guaranteed co-operation will form a bridge of mutual help and support.”

STRONG NATIONS HERR HITLER IN ROME PROMISES OF FRIENDSHIP united Press Assn.— Elec. TeL Copyrtarni ROME, May 8 Two hundred guests attended the banquet given in honour of Herr Hitler at the Palazza Venezia. Signor Mussolini, welcoming the Fuehrer, declared his visit sealed the GermanItalian understanding which they had so firmly willed and tenaciously constructed, and which had a historic function in the parallel and permanent interests of the two nations. "Fascist Italy knows only one ethical law—the friendship which lias been obtained by German-Italian collaboration and consecrated in the Rome-Berlin axis," said Signor Mussolini. "Italy and Germany abandoned the Utopias to which Europe blindly entrusted its fortunes in order to seek, between themselves and with others, a regime of international cooperation which may erect more effective guarantees of justice, security and equitable peace. This can only be reached when the elementary rights of each people to live, work and defend itself arc loyally recognised and political equilibrium corresponds with historical realities.” Nazl-lsm and Fascism Herr Hitler, responding, said .Naziism and Fascism had created two new and powerful nations—a block of 120.000,000 people who were determined to preserve their eternal right to live and to protect their equal interests and ideological unity against all forces endeavouring to resist their natural development. “It is my unshakeable will and legacy to Germany,” said the Fuehrer, "that it forever regards the ItaioGerman alpine frontier as inviolable.” Herr Hitler added: “Just as you and the Italians preserved friendship toward Germany In her decisive days, so shall I and my people show Italy friendship In a serious hour.”
